Output 3094b8dca2c278f2a84ffb4b10a542cd8b43aa996f9b65a840ed7bf8d1fb1a34:30

value
422985
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1479efac5cd0cd42c76bb5fc44c7612703b75617 OP_EQUAL
address
33ZHWf6poSGPHFw7uc4pDeePGCw3dWCCi6
transaction
3094b8dca2c278f2a84ffb4b10a542cd8b43aa996f9b65a840ed7bf8d1fb1a34
confirmations
151314
spent
true